Bilayer Low-Density Parity-Check Codes for Decode-and-Forward in Relay Channels
From MaRDI portal
Publication:3549014
DOI10.1109/TIT.2007.904983zbMATH Open1325.94075arXivcs/0609018OpenAlexW3100777080MaRDI QIDQ3549014FDOQ3549014
Publication date: 21 December 2008
Published in: IEEE Transactions on Information Theory (Search for Journal in Brave)
Abstract: This paper describes an efficient implementation of binning for the relay channel using low-density parity-check (LDPC) codes. We devise bilayer LDPC codes to approach the theoretically promised rate of the decode-and-forward relaying strategy by incorporating relay-generated information bits in specially designed bilayer graphical code structures. While conventional LDPC codes are sensitively tuned to operate efficiently at a certain channel parameter, the proposed bilayer LDPC codes are capable of working at two different channel parameters and two different rates: that at the relay and at the destination. To analyze the performance of bilayer LDPC codes, bilayer density evolution is devised as an extension of the standard density evolution algorithm. Based on bilayer density evolution, a design methodology is developed for the bilayer codes in which the degree distribution is iteratively improved using linear programming. Further, in order to approach the theoretical decode-and-forward rate for a wide range of channel parameters, this paper proposes two different forms bilayer codes, the bilayer-expurgated and bilayer-lengthened codes. It is demonstrated that a properly designed bilayer LDPC code can achieve an asymptotic infinite-length threshold within 0.24 dB gap to the Shannon limits of two different channels simultaneously for a wide range of channel parameters. By practical code construction, finite-length bilayer codes are shown to be able to approach within a 0.6 dB gap to the theoretical decode-and-forward rate of the relay channel at a block length of and a bit-error probability (BER) of . Finally, it is demonstrated that a generalized version of the proposed bilayer code construction is applicable to relay networks with multiple relays.
Full work available at URL: https://arxiv.org/abs/cs/0609018
Cited In (4)
- Performance analysis for cooperative communication system with QC-LDPC codes constructed with integer sequences
- Coding and Decoding for the Dynamic Decode and Forward Relay Protocol
- Low-Density Graph Codes for Coded Cooperation on Slow Fading Relay Channels
- Compress-Forward Coding With BPSK Modulation for the Half-Duplex Gaussian Relay Channel
Recommendations
- Layered Coding for the Interference Channel With a Relay π π
- Coding for Parallel Gaussian Bidirectional Relay Channels: A Deterministic Approach π π
- Low-Density Parity-Check Codes for Nonergodic Block-Fading Channels π π
- Lattice Codes for the Gaussian Relay Channel: Decode-and-Forward and Compress-and-Forward π π
- On Decoding of Low-Density Parity-Check Codes Over the Binary Erasure Channel π π
- Generalized Backward Decoding Strategies for the Relay Channel π π
- Using Superposition Codebooks and Partial Decode-and-Forward in Low-SNR Parallel Relay Networks π π
- A Multi-Layer Encoding and Decoding Strategy for Binary Erasure Channel π π
- Joint Physical Layer Coding and Network Coding for Bidirectional Relaying π π
- A Constrained Coding Approach to Error-Free Half-Duplex Relay Networks π π
This page was built for publication: Bilayer Low-Density Parity-Check Codes for Decode-and-Forward in Relay Channels
Report a bug (only for logged in users!)Click here to report a bug for this page (MaRDI item Q3549014)